-- etldoc: layer_poi[shape=record fillcolor=lightpink, style="rounded,filled",
-- etldoc: label="layer_poi | <z14_> z14+" ] ;
CREATE OR REPLACE FUNCTION layer_poi(bbox geometry, zoom_level integer, pixel_width numeric)
RETURNS TABLE(osm_id bigint, geometry geometry, name text, name_en text, name_de text, tags hstore, class text, subclass text, "rank" int) AS $$
SELECT osm_id, geometry, NULLIF(name, '') AS name,
COALESCE(NULLIF(name_en, ''), name) AS name_en,
COALESCE(NULLIF(name_de, ''), name, name_en) AS name_de,
tags,
poi_class(subclass, mapping_key) AS class, subclass,
row_number() OVER (
PARTITION BY LabelGrid(geometry, 100 * pixel_width)
ORDER BY CASE WHEN name = '' THEN 2000 ELSE poi_class_rank(poi_class(subclass, mapping_key)) END ASC
)::int AS "rank"
FROM (
-- etldoc: osm_poi_point -> layer_poi:z14_
SELECT * FROM osm_poi_point
WHERE geometry && bbox
AND zoom_level >= 14
UNION ALL
-- etldoc: osm_poi_polygon -> layer_poi:z14_
SELECT * FROM osm_poi_polygon
WHERE geometry && bbox
AND zoom_level >= 14
) as poi_union
ORDER BY "rank"
;
$$ LANGUAGE SQL IMMUTABLE;
